Hampshire Constabulary have launched a murder investigation in Havant
Details of Incident
Two women have been arrested as part of a murder investigation in Havant.
We were called at 8.04am today (17 July) to an address in Botley Drive, Havant.
Officers attended and the body of a man in his 20s was found inside the property.
His next of kin have been informed.
A 26-year-old woman from Havant was arrested on suspicion of murder and a 26-year-old woman from Paulsgrove was arrested on suspicion of murder and conspiracy to murder.
Both remain in police custody at this time.
A scene is in place at the address in Botley Drive and officers will be conducting reassurance patrols in the area.
Detectives continue to investigate the circumstances of the incident.
Detective Chief Inspector Nicola Burton said: “This incident will be concerning to members of the local community and we are working hard to establish exactly what happened.
“While our investigation is at an early stage, we do not believe there is any wider risk to the public.
“We are not looking for anyone else in connection with this incident.
